Another Taste

She was shaking
like a newborn crack baby,
blue eyed and
desperate for a fix;
a loving touch.

I let my arms
fall around her shivering body
and realize that
I should not be diluted
by my obsession,
but this is just too much
for my small hands
to grasp and potentially
form into perfection.

I know that if
I held her any closer
She would suffocate
on the cotton
and plastic lettering
of my shirt,
but I really do need
something more
than filtered air
and bottled water
to give me peace of mind.

I trace the rivets
of her spine
letting the bumps
dissolve beneath my fingers.

I will always return
for another taste
of the angel's white spine.

She knows this
by now,
and once again
I shudder
at my defeat.
